Incroslip™ SL
by Cargill
Incroslip™ SL by Cargill acts as anti-scratch and slip agent. It offers long-lasting & high slip performance, excellent color & oxidative stability and improved organoleptic properties. It is a specially developed food approved additive. It is used in caps & closures, automotive, biopolymers, injection molding and film production.
- It is stable in applications exposed to UV light.
- It provides low visible bloom, scuff resistance and mold- & torque release properties.
- It is suitable for polyethylene (LDPE, LLDPE, HDPE), polypropylene (PP) and all polyolefins applications.
- The recommended dosage level is 0.1-0.25% for film grades, 0.2-0.5% for injection molding grades and upto 1% for compression molding grades.
- Incroslip™ SL has a shelf life of 2 year.

IncroMax™ PS
by Cargill
IncroMax™ PS by Cargill acts as a processing aid and anti-scratch agent for styrenics. It provides mold release, scuff- and scratch resistance and surface quality enhancement. It migrates to the surface of the polymer where it forms a thin lubricating layer, which reduces the coefficient of friction between surfaces and reduces unwanted adhesion.
- It offers improved de-nesting and packing of preforms.
- It has a vegetable origin and can be dispersed evenly through the polymer in melt phase.
- It is easy to process and produces fewer rejected parts and less waste.
- It improves output rate, reduces temperature and extruder speeds in processing.
- IncroMax™ PS is suitable for use in PMMA and clear/opaque HIPS and GPPS.
- It is non-toxic and has no adverse effects on the physical properties of the polymer and reduces manufacturing noise.
- It is recommended for automotive-, houseware- and furniture plastics, cosmetics jars and bottles, food containers, trays, film production, and injection molding applications.
- It has a shelf life of 365 days.

Atmer™ 7002
by Cargill
Atmer™ 7002 by Cargill is a vegetable-based anti-static agent. It is a 50% concentrate in polypropylene that provides lubrication and mold release benefits. It allows for better dispersion and overcomes complications encountered when using additives in their normal physical forms.
- Concentrates are added to the process like other resins, allowing for the additives to migrate to the surface of the polymer where they interact with atmospheric moisture, reducing surface resistivity and allowing dissipation of static charge.
- It exhibits reduction of fuming/smoking in processing.
- It offers better distribution of additives in base polymer, effective dosing of additives and less volatiles in processing.
- Atmer™ 7002 is recommended for PP closures & caps and film applications.
- Recommended dosage level is 0.5-1.6% in injection molding and sheet extrusion.
- It has a shelf life of 730 days.

Einar® 211
by Palsgaard
Einar® 211 by Palsgaard is a plant-based, internal food-grade, general-purpose anti-fog additive for polyethylene-based masterbatches and PVC cling film applications. It is a high-quality distilled monoglyceride made from fatty acids and glycerol, based on sunflower oil, and is produced in CO2 neutral factories.
- It is used in many conventional food packaging applications to obtain a good & reliable performance in both cold and hot fog conditions.
- It is fast-acting and keeps food wrap films & other types of packaging transparent during cold storage.
- It works well in both monolayer and coextruded PE film.
- In PVC, the recommended dosage level for cold fog applications is 0.5-1.0% and for hot fog applications is 0.3-0.6%.
- In LDPE or LLDPE, the recommended dosage level for cold fog applications is 0.3-0.6% and for hot fog applications is 0.2-0.4%.
- It has a minimum shelf life of 12 months.

Raven FC1
by Birla Carbon
Raven FC1 by Birla Carbon is a high performance, carbon black grade with high purity. It offers extremely low physical impurities, easy dispersability, long screen life, smooth surface finish and low moisture pick-up. It provides defect-free films and excellent chemical cleanliness. Raven FC1 is recommended for indirect food-contact plastics like packaging & containers, food processing equipment, cutlery, dishes and utensils. It complies with U.S. FDA 21 CFR 178.3297 indirect food-contact applications.
